Market Context
CPS Tech has experienced a sharp pullback in recent trading sessions, with shares declining by nearly 20% to $4.30 as of today. The move has been accompanied by a notable spike in volume, suggesting active repositioning by market participants. The stock is now testing a key support level near $4.08, a zone that has historically attracted buying interest. On the upside, the $4.51 resistance area looms as the next technical hurdle for any potential rebound.
The broader technology sector has faced headwinds this month, with investors rotating out of growth-oriented names amid shifting macroeconomic expectations. CPS Tech's decline appears partly tied to sector-wide profit-taking, though company-specific factors—such as recent earnings reports or product updates—may also be weighing on sentiment. Without confirmed catalysts, the movement aligns with typical volatility seen in small-cap innovation stocks.
Volume data indicates heavy trading activity during the drop, which could suggest either panic selling or accumulation by institutional players at lower prices. The relative strength index (RSI) is approaching oversold territory, hinting at a possible stabilization in the near term. However, until the stock reclaims the $4.15–$4.30 zone, the path of least resistance remains downward. Traders are watching the $4.08 support closely, as a break below this level could open the door to further downside.

Technical Analysis
CPS Tech’s (CPSH) price action in recent weeks has been testing the key support zone near $4.08, with the stock currently trading at $4.30. The $4.08 level has held multiple times, forming a potential double-bottom pattern on the daily chart. If this support continues to hold, the stock may attempt to challenge the nearby resistance at $4.51, a level that has capped upside moves since early May. A decisive move above $4.51 would likely signal a shift from the recent sideways-to-lower trend, while a breakdown below $4.08 could open the door to further downside.
Technical indicators currently suggest a mixed but slightly oversold condition. Momentum oscillators have been hovering in the lower third of their ranges, indicating that selling pressure may be nearing exhaustion. Volume has been relatively normal during the recent consolidation, with no signs of heavy distribution. The 50-day moving average is sloping downward, reflecting the intermediate-term downtrend, but the price is attempting to stabilize above the short-term support.
Traders are watching for a consolidation pattern—a narrowing range between $4.08 and $4.51—which often precedes a breakout. Without a catalyst, CPSH may remain range-bound, but the chart setup warrants attention as the stock approaches a decision point. Any move above $4.51 with increased volume could confirm a reversal pattern, while a sustained break below $4.08 would likely extend the downtrend.
